Visual Studio Code is a lightweight, highly customizable code editor with a rich extension ecosystem, making it suitable for a wide range of programming tasks. In contrast, Komodo IDE is a more traditional IDE that offers robust support for multiple languages and built-in tools, but it may not match the community-driven flexibility and popularity of VS Code.
